Wednesday -- Breakfast was leisurely, then we strolled along the riverside, admiring the old buildings in this part of Mompox, and spotting several iguanas. The houses are single-story, but there is significant flood protection along the banks. We were back on board well before we sailed at 10:15 and just relaxed until lunch, and then played cards after lunch until time for the story of pirates, buccaneers and privateers in this area. A nap took us to time for the lively onboard performance of Cumbria music, and dance with El Banco. For the performance all the ladies were given fascinators, and the men red bandanas.
